Output e15c336ed82ee5bc15a216254c5d824184cbab821167c9d245fa3fb1f8a54678:7

value
3032600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8281874b2b8af3d62d56056bac5fdf58e439b143 OP_EQUALVERIFY OP_CHECKSIG
address
1Cu41jeSrDmpYusJXryt75oV9TCq9dz3LC
transaction
e15c336ed82ee5bc15a216254c5d824184cbab821167c9d245fa3fb1f8a54678
spent
true